MS Live Search goes Live
p2pnet.net News:- Bill and the Boyz say their Live Search and Live.com are now out of beta, also trumpeting the, “final availability of Live Local Search in the U.K. and the U.S.”
“Microsoft also announced that Live Search will now power the Web search capability on MSN, the company’s media and entertainment portal,” it says.
Or you can, “Share your smarts on Live QnA” which, “connects you to the best answers from the right people,” the guy with the dogs on the QnA page being, presumably, one such.
The interface is, “minimalist, like Google’s,” and search has a slider feature, “that controls the sizes of thumbnails on the results page, and QnA, in beta, is similar to Yahoo Answers,” says ZDNet’s Between the Lines, adding, “and one day Google’s worst nightmare could come true – to Google means to search on any site, even Live Search, which isn’t easily turned into a verb”.
